Загрузка...

I Built a Tool That Audits Any Figma File — Here's What It Found

Figma files always look clean in the editor. But the moment you hand off to dev — rogue hex values, detached components, unstyled text nodes, spacing that's almost-but-not-quite on grid. Figma Inspector audits the whole file in seconds and tells you exactly what's wrong, where, and how often.

🔗 Try it: https://figmascope.dev
(runs entirely in your browser — your token never leaves your machine)



What the tool audits:
• Off-token colors and near-duplicate hex values
• Unstyled text nodes (used more than once with no shared style attached)
• Detached component instances (componentId not found in file)
• Hidden and locked layers across all pages
• Token coverage — what % of color uses are on named styles

What you get back:
• A file score (0–100) with letter grade
• Full issue list with severity, location, and occurrence count
• Color token breakdown — candidate tokens, untokenized drifters, rogue values
• CSS custom properties ready to paste into your stylesheet
• Shareable markdown/JSON report for PRs and design reviews



🛠️ Built with:
• Vanilla JS — no framework, no build step
• Figma REST API (read-only, personal access token)
• Runs 100% in the browser — zero server, zero telemetry

The whole thing is a single HTML + JS file you can inspect, fork, or self-host.

🔗 figmascope.dev

#FigmaInspector #FigmaTools #DesignSystem #UIDesign #FrontendDevelopment #DesignTokens #Figma #WebDevelopment #DeveloperTools #IndieHacker #DesignHandoff #CSSVariables #DesignQuality #AITools #DesignEngineering —

🔗 Links
Website: https://roman-tsisyk.com/
LinkedIn: https://www.linkedin.com/in/roman-tsisyk/
GitHub: https://github.com/RomanTsisyk

Видео I Built a Tool That Audits Any Figma File — Here's What It Found канала Roman Tsisyk — Android Systems
Яндекс.Метрика
Все заметки Новая заметка Страницу в заметки
Страницу в закладки Мои закладки
На информационно-развлекательном портале SALDA.WS применяются cookie-файлы. Нажимая кнопку Принять, вы подтверждаете свое согласие на их использование.
О CookiesНапомнить позжеПринять